Folks have reported being able to access the LAX NZ lounge for $55 on a "day pass" basis.. at least when flying in Y on NZ...

Can't find any reports of pax flying out on other *A airlines doing the same...

With the AC lounge right next door (but not worth using IMO- no showers!) NZ may not offer paid access to AC pax...but I just don't know....

It has to be worth a try! Opening hours will need to be checked I suppose...
